Output 86daa1a73509cafb62ef5b492666c7b4e03c53d8e86ad45d2bc1ebc78651f21e:0

value
8738884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ddba5f52ed982804c2d289c0098b2eb65763f1 OP_EQUAL
address
3FdJFdmLHTvYQ4TBHxVUh2d6NWYR2VimfB
transaction
86daa1a73509cafb62ef5b492666c7b4e03c53d8e86ad45d2bc1ebc78651f21e
spent
true